All motor boats will cruise to new destinations to save Upper Lake of Bhopal

Prior to this development, in March, MP tourism approached the Apex Court, seeking relief from a National Green Tribunal (NGT) order that mandated the cessation of cruise vessels and other motor-propelled boats in the Bhoj wetland, which is a UNESCO Ramsar Site. Bhoj Wetland, Bhopal was declared as a Ramsar Site in 2002. It is spread in 3201 hectares. MPSTDC is a government agency that conducts and regulates the tourism activities in the state.
